Love Machine

Industry legend Garry Marshall is set to direct the comedy "Valentine's Day" says Variety.

The story centers around ten people in Los Angeles whose cross paths on the day of love.

Abby Kohn and Marc Silverstein (Friday's "He's Just Not That Into You") performed a rewrite of Katherine Fugate's original script.

Marshall's flicks in the rom-com genre tend to quite well--Pretty Woman, The Princess Diaries and the like.. with their crowd pleasing appeal

The film is being fast-tracked for a Valentine's Day 2010 release.
